Jump to main content
MPLAB® XC8 PIC Assembler User's Guide for Embedded Engineers
Search
Notice to Development Tools Customers
1
Preface
1.1
Conventions Used in This Guide
1.2
Recommended Reading
2
Introduction
3
A Basic Example For PIC18 Devices
3.1
Comments
3.2
Configuration Bits
3.3
Include Files
3.4
Commonly Used Directives
3.5
Predefined Psects
3.6
User-defined Psects for PIC18 Devices
3.7
Building the Example
4
A Basic Example For Mid-range Devices
4.1
Assembler Macros
4.2
User-defined Psects for Mid-range and Baseline Devices
4.3
Working with Data Banks
4.4
Building the Example
5
Multiple Source Files, Paging and Linear Memory Example
5.1
Multiple Source Files and Shared Access
5.2
Psect Concatenation And Paging
5.3
Linear Memory
5.4
Building the Example
6
Compiled Stack Example
6.1
Compiled Stack Directives
6.2
Compiler Stack Allocation
6.3
Building the Example
7
Interrupts and Bits Example For Mid-range Devices
7.1
Interrupt Code (Mid-range)
7.2
Defining And Using Bits
7.3
Manual Context Switch
7.4
Building the Example
8
Interrupts and Bits Example For PIC18 Devices
8.1
Interrupt Code (PIC18)
8.2
Defining And Using Bits
8.3
Building the Example
9
Baseline Code Example
9.1
Routine Entry Points
9.2
Building the Example
10
Document Revision History
The Microchip Website
Product Change Notification Service
Customer Support
Microchip Devices Code Protection Feature
Legal Notice
Trademarks
Quality Management System
Worldwide Sales and Service